An Inquiry Into The Character And Origin Of The Possessive Augment: In English And In Cognate Dialects (1864) is a book written by James Manning. The book explores the origins and characteristics of the possessive augment in English and its related dialects. The author delves into the history of the English language and the various dialects spoken in different regions, analyzing the use of the possessive augment in each of these dialects. The book provides a detailed analysis of the linguistic evolution of the English language and its related dialects, and is a valuable resource for linguists, historians, and anyone interested in the evolution of language.
